BANVEL Herbicide POST-EMERGENCE APPLICATION IN BROADLEAF WEED PROBLEM * Yoder Cow Completes Record A Registered Holstein cow owned by Jefferson D. Yoder, Elverson, Pennsylvania, has completed a production record exceeding 30,000 lbs. of milk, according to the Holstein- Friesian Association of America Rocky-Side Lena 5753321 (EX 3E) actually produced a total of 32,543 lbs. of milk and 1,099 lbs. of butterfat in 365 days.
